About the Role We are looking for a Production Operations Manager to join our growing team. In this role, you'll help guide products through the full development and production lifecycle-partnering with customers, coordinating with our factory teams, and making sure every detail is right from concept through final delivery. If you enjoy managing projects end-to-end, solving problems proactively, and working closely with both creative and technical partners, you'll feel right at home here. Positions Responsibilities Partner with customers to support product design and development, helping bring new headwear ideas to life Prepare, update, and manage all documentation (tech packs) - including materials, specs, trims, and artwork details - needed for accurate sampling and production Maintain clear, timely communication with customers throughout the development process, ensuring expectations are aligned and projects stay on track Coordinate and support daily communication with our factories, troubleshooting issues and keeping production running smoothly Maintain our internal systems and data with accuracy and consistency Minimum Qualifications Bachelor's degree 3+ years of relevant professional experience, preferably in apparel, design, and/or product development Excellent communication and interpersonal skills Proven track record of problemsolving with both internal and external partners Strong attention to detail, accuracy, and organization Ability to manage multiple projects and deadlines with ease Preferred Qualifications Experience in the apparel or accessories industry Experience with Adobe Illustrator (preferred) and Photoshop (a plus) Benefits Health insurance with HSA options 401(k) retirement plan Paid holidays and flexible PTO Opportunities for workrelated travel A small, tightknit team where your voice is heard and your work has a real impact A creative environment where collaboration, autonomy, and ownership are part of everyday life
